1. Change Your Air Filters Regularly

This is like the “drink more water” of heating system care. It’s simple but often overlooked. Your furnace’s air filter is constantly battling dust and debris. You can help it out! Make a resolution to change your filters regularly to keep your system running smoothly.

3. Improve Your Indoor Air Quality

Your furnace is more than a heat provider; it’s part of your home’s respiratory system. Consider adding humidifiers or air purifiers to the mix. For example, the Dust Free® Carbon Air Purifier is a 100% ozone-free system that uses a combination of carbon and germicidal UV-C light technology to purify the air and surfaces in your home’s heating and cooling system. 4. Add Zoning Systems

Here’s another possible New Year’s resolution depending on who’s living in your home. Ever fought over the thermostat with someone who thinks 65 degrees is tropical? Zoning systems allow different temperatures in different rooms. Finally, a diplomatic solution to the age-old thermostat wars!

6. Adjust Your Thermostat

Sometimes, the simplest actions make the biggest difference. Adjusting your thermostat by even a few degrees can save energy and money. In fact, you can save approximately 10% a month on your heating bill by turning down the thermostat for 8 hours each night. It’s the little things that count.
